About Black River Technical College

Black River Technical College is a small institution located in Pocahontas, Arkansas, primarily awarding the certificate. It enrolls roughly 903 undergraduate students in a town setting. The most popular fields of study include Health professions, Liberal arts, Mechanic & repair.

Cost & tuition

The average net price at Black River Technical College — what a typical student actually pays after grants and scholarships — is $5,095 per year, which is very affordable compared to other U.S. institutions. Sticker tuition runs $4,776 for in-state students and $7,488 for out-of-state students before aid. Total cost of attendance, including housing, books, and living expenses, comes to about $14,374 annually.

Graduation & earnings outcomes

The 6-year graduation rate is 54.5%, a above-average completion outcome. Ten years after enrolling, the median graduate earns $34,818 per year according to U.S. Department of Education earnings tracking.

Programs & majors

Black River Technical College confers degrees and certificates across 13 broad program areas, with the largest concentrations of completions in Health professions, Liberal arts, Mechanic & repair. Grouped into wider academic categories, the mix is led by health (42% of credentials), trades & services (29% of credentials), humanities & arts (14% of credentials), which gives a quick read on the school's overall academic profile. Admissions

Admission rate data is not reported for this institution, which is typical for open-admission community and trade schools.
